A replica of the inter-war period Boeing Model 266 (P-26) "Peashooter" (so named for the prominent gun sight tube above the engine cowling) fighter, the Mayocraft P-26D in the fabulous colors of the United States Army Air Corps 94th Squadron, 1st Pursuit Group circa 1935, takes flight.
